Output b389ee26668285353484629715825b12e8ff802c12ce5a91081227011d137209:24

value
520840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8aa266aee23134b8705ebaf9c42f8921e2c5d53 OP_EQUAL
address
3NuEXHLVH1bTTNBUDq2BTJES1aQvzjNRfh
transaction
b389ee26668285353484629715825b12e8ff802c12ce5a91081227011d137209